Xbox App Download | Download Completely Free
SponsoredApposee offers free download of Xbox app with information and reviews. Install the …Free Xbox Download | Install Latest Xbox | 100% Free Download
SponsoredInstall Free Xbox on Android & iOS! Download Xbox and Enjoy the Convenience

Feedback